Driver in Edinboro triple-fatal cited 3 days prior

EDINBORO, Pa. (AP) — The driver who police say caused a two-car crash that killed three Edinboro University students last week had been cited for careless driving and underage drinking three days earlier.

Court records show campus police cited 18-year-old Domenico Crea, of Erie, after he allegedly drove 40 mph in a campus parking lot, and was later determined to be drinking on Nov. 8, about 3 a.m.

Police say Crea was speeding and trying to pass another car when he crashed head-on into another vehicle near the school Wednesday afternoon. Crea and his passenger, 18-year-old John Eyrolles of Pittsburgh, were killed as was the other driver, 21-year-old Sheldon Harmon of Bolivar, N.Y.

Edinboro is one of 14 state-owned universities in Pennsylvania. It is located about 15 miles south of Erie.
